Ed Bernard, vice-chairman of T Rowe Price, discusses the Baltimore firm's investment in Indian asset management company Unit Trust of India.

In January, Baltimore-based asset manager T Rowe Price acquired a 26% stake in India's largest fund manager, Unit Trust of India, for Rs6.5 billion ($142.4 million). The acquisition was achieved via a sell-down of 6.5% by each of UTI's four original shareholders, State Bank of India, Punjab National Bank, Bank of Baroda and the Life Insurance Corporation of India.
